How the dive-ability score works
The 0–100 score combines six components with calibrated weights (penalty-points model from VIZ.net.au + Morrison 2021):
- Estimated visibility (30 pts) — derived from 7-day cumulative rainfall, rolling swell, satellite chlorophyll-a and per-site sedimentation factor.
- Swell (25 pts) — significant height + period. Long-period groundswell amplifies impact.
- Season (15 pts) — comparison with the per-site curated optimal / to-avoid months.
- Current (15 pts) — scaled against the site baseline.
- Wind (10 pts) — affects entry, surface comfort and water mixing.
- Tide (5 pts) — only for sites with strong tidal sensitivity (Bocas, Golfo San Matías, etc.).
Data sources
- Open-Meteo Marine — swell, wind, currents, sea-surface temperature, tide (no API key).
- Copernicus Marine Service — chlorophyll-a (visibility proxy), currents at depth. Attribution required.
- NOAA CPC Oceanic Niño Index (ONI) — monthly ENSO phase.
- NOAA Coral Reef Watch — bleaching alerts (integration in progress).
- Sites curated from Parques Nacionales Naturales (CO, AR), CONANP (MX), SINAC (CR), MiAmbiente (PA), ICMBio (BR), Galápagos National Park Directorate (EC), Belize Audubon Society, and verified operators.
Known limitations
- Real visibility depends on factors that can't be observed by satellite (local turbidity, prior-day diver traffic). The score is indicative, not deterministic.
- Per-site directional exposure vectors (
exposure_vector,lee_vector) are not fully populated yet — the current score uses absolute thresholds. Per-site calibration is in phase 5. - Some coordinates are approximated to zone/island level. Public sources rarely publish exact GPS for dive sites. Operator verification is in progress.
